Output 2582f9ef1e0cd7c166ca6a4ced8d139d300f6032317c9e16bf60a7fbc40155e1:49

value
17254836
script pubkey
OP_0 OP_PUSHBYTES_20 266f190088b6a32faaa995c0c644050da52c436c
address
ltc1qyeh3jqygk63jl24fjhqvv3q9pkjjcsmvj8f6sn
transaction
2582f9ef1e0cd7c166ca6a4ced8d139d300f6032317c9e16bf60a7fbc40155e1
spent
true